Meeting and Pickup Information
This small group tour of the Cité de Carcassonne begins at the Place du Prado, 11000 Carcassonne, France.
Travelers will meet their certified guide at this central location. The tour ends back at the meeting point.
The meeting and end point are accessible via public transportation, making it convenient for visitors.
The tour is suitable for those with moderate physical fitness, as it requires some walking.
Strollers and service animals are allowed, though the tour isn’t wheelchair accessible.

Accessibility and Physical Requirements
The Cité de Carcassonne tour is accessible to strollers, and service animals are welcome. However, the tour is not wheelchair accessible due to the uneven terrain and cobblestone streets within the medieval city. Participants should have a moderate level of physical fitness, as the tour involves a significant amount of walking and climbing stairs to explore the castle museum and fortifications.
